Transaction 237162b4ffeffbdb2fae10a1be29fbaa7653f1544d41a6f3773f53cdc235f3c5

177 Input
2 Outputs
  • 237162b4ffeffbdb2fae10a1be29fbaa7653f1544d41a6f3773f53cdc235f3c5:0
  • value  10000000
    address  3BP7dD6NGM7bGYaWxJYAPf25B7cMubsLCc
  • 237162b4ffeffbdb2fae10a1be29fbaa7653f1544d41a6f3773f53cdc235f3c5:1
  • value  20375605
    address  35DtrFrFbAADodxeZ3bzs4ZFR8SrtsoSxV